服务器端日志会记录什么
-
服务器端日志是指在服务器上记录各种系统和应用程序活动的文件,它可以提供关于服务器的运行状态、错误和异常信息的详细记录。服务器端日志的内容可以包括以下几个方面:
-
服务器启动和关闭信息:日志记录服务器启动和关闭的时间、进程ID等信息,以及相关状态和事件。
-
访问日志:记录所有对服务器的访问请求,包括来自用户或其他系统的HTTP请求、FTP请求、数据库请求等。这些日志可以包含访问时间、访问者的IP地址、请求页面、请求方法、访问状态码等。
-
错误日志:记录服务器出现的错误和异常信息,如程序出现的崩溃、数据库连接错误、文件系统错误等。这些日志可以帮助管理员追踪问题和找出错误原因。
-
安全日志:用于记录服务器上的安全事件,如登录尝试失败、恶意攻击、系统访问权限变更等。它可以帮助管理员检测和防范潜在的安全威胁。
-
性能日志:用于记录服务器系统和应用程序的性能指标,如CPU使用率、内存占用、磁盘IO等。这些日志可以帮助管理员评估服务器的负载情况,优化系统性能和资源分配。
-
调试日志:用于记录系统和应用程序的调试信息,如函数调用栈、变量值等。这些日志可以帮助开发人员定位和解决程序中的bug。
-
业务日志:根据服务器上运行的具体应用程序的需求,记录特定业务相关的信息,如用户操作记录、交易日志、订单信息等。这些日志可以用于追踪用户行为、数据分析和业务监控。
总之,服务器端日志是服务器管理和应用程序开发的重要工具,通过记录各种活动信息,可以帮助管理员和开发人员监测服务器状态、排查故障、追踪问题,并进行系统优化和业务分析。
1年前 -
-
服务器端日志可以记录以下内容:
-
访问日志:服务器端日志最常见的记录就是用户的访问日志,包括用户的IP地址、访问时间、请求的URL地址、浏览器版本等。这些信息可以用来分析网站的流量、访问趋势和用户行为。
-
错误日志:服务器端日志还会记录网站发生的错误,如页面找不到、服务器内部错误等。通过查阅错误日志,可以帮助开发人员快速定位和解决网站的问题。
-
安全日志:服务器端日志也能记录网站的安全信息,如恶意攻击、登录尝试等。安全日志可以用来监控网站的安全状况,发现潜在的安全威胁,并采取相应的防护措施。
-
性能日志:服务器端日志还可以记录网站的性能信息,如请求的响应时间、服务器的负载状况等。通过分析性能日志,能够了解网站的性能瓶颈,进行相应的优化和调整。
-
数据库日志:如果网站使用了数据库,服务器端日志还会记录数据库的操作日志,如查询、更新、插入等。数据库日志可以用来进行数据追踪、事务回滚等操作。
总结:服务器端日志记录了用户访问日志、错误日志、安全日志、性能日志和数据库日志等信息。通过分析这些日志,可以了解网站的访问情况、问题定位、安全状况、性能优化和数据库操作等相关内容。
1年前 -
-
服务器端日志是记录服务器运行和执行过程中产生的所有事件和信息的文件。它包含了一系列的操作记录、错误信息、服务器负载情况、安全事件等内容。服务器端日志对于系统管理员来说非常重要,可以用来监控服务器的运行状态、故障排查、性能优化等。
下面是服务器端日志可能会记录的内容:
-
访问日志:记录服务器接收到的所有访问请求,包括客户端的IP地址、请求的URL、请求的方法、请求的时间、响应状态码等信息。这些日志可以用来分析网站的访问情况、用户行为和趋势,以及进行访问量监控和流量统计。
-
错误日志:记录服务器在处理请求过程中出现的错误和异常情况,包括系统错误、应用程序错误、数据库错误等。这些日志可以用来帮助开发人员定位和解决问题,以及提供更好的用户体验。
-
安全日志:记录服务器上的安全事件和攻击行为,包括登录尝试、非法访问、跨站脚本攻击、SQL注入等。这些日志可以用来监控服务器的安全情况,及时发现和防范潜在的安全威胁。
-
系统日志:记录服务器操作系统的运行状态和事件,包括系统启动、关机、硬件故障、进程启动和停止等。这些日志可以帮助系统管理员进行故障排查、资源调度和性能分析。
-
应用程序日志:记录服务器上运行的应用程序的日志信息,包括应用程序的运行状态、调试信息、业务操作等。这些日志可以辅助开发人员进行系统调试和问题分析,优化系统性能和功能。
-
性能日志:记录服务器的性能指标和负载情况,包括CPU使用率、内存使用率、磁盘IO、网络流量等。这些日志可以用来进行服务器性能优化和资源调度,保证服务器的稳定和高效运行。
为了方便管理和分析日志,通常会使用日志管理工具,如ELK(Elasticsearch+Logstash+Kibana)等,来收集、存储、索引和可视化日志数据。管理员可以通过查看和分析服务器日志,及时发现问题、优化系统,并且保证服务器的安全和稳定性。
1年前 -